The combined mean of the 14 people's index finger is: 12.75 cm.

<h3>How to Find the Combined Mean?</h3>

Combined mean = [(mean of first group × number of data of the first group) + (mean of second group × number of data of the second group)] ÷ (number of data of the first group + number of data of the second group).

Given the following:

Mean of first group = 7.8

Number of data of the first group = 7

Mean of second group = 17.7

Number of data of the second group = 7

Combined mean = [(7.8 × 7) + (17.7 × 7)] / (7 + 7)

Combined mean = 178.5 / 14

Combined mean = 12.75 cm.

The quantity of water the farming conglomerate would use 17 years from now is 65,708.11.

<h3>What is the amount of water that would be used 17 years from now?</h3>

The formula for calculating the amount of water that would be needed 1 years from now:

FV = P (1 + r)^N

  • FV = Future value
  • P = Present value
  • R = interest rate
  • N = number of years

13000 x 1.1^17 = 65,708.11
